Staff Backend Engineer - Developer Experience (Ruby)
An overview of this role As a Staff Backend Engineer in the Developer Experience group, you’ll work cross-functionally to help us identify and improve the engineering experience across GitLab’s internal engineering teams. We’re at a pivotal time in transforming our testing approach and development experience to enable engineers to deliver high-quality code efficiently and with confidence.
About the team
Our Developer Experience group currently has six globally distributed teams of Backend Engineers and Software Engineers in Test. In this role, you’ll work across our entire group to identify and remove the biggest points of friction that affect development at GitLab. You’ll split your time between hands-on coding in Ruby and Go, designing scalable solutions, and helping every team deliver. You’ll also be instrumental in shaping our engineering culture across GitLab.
This is a highly visible role with strong company-wide support. You’ll be instrumental in shifting our culture and practices toward a cohesive Developer Experience Platform strategy, backed by buy-in and appetite for change.
What you’ll do
Drive Technical Excellence Across Teams: Provide hands-on engineering contributions and technical leadership across six Developer Experience teams, jumping in to unblock critical work or accelerate high-impact initiatives.
Champion Engineering Needs: Partner with engineering teams across GitLab to identify pain points, gather feedback, and translate day-to-day frustrations into actionable improvements for the Developer Experience roadmap.
Transform Testing at Scale: Help us modernize our testing to support GitLab's growth and ensure engineers have fast, reliable tools that catch issues early without slowing them down.
Optimize CI/CD Pipelines: Reduce merge and CI friction by building workflows that deliver fast, actionable feedback and help engineers iterate confidently and ship faster.
Break Down Systemic Bottlenecks: Collaborate with Platform, Product, and Infrastructure teams to identify and eliminate the architectural and process friction that slows down development.
Shape Engineering Culture: Foster a culture of continuous learning, inclusion, and improvement, where great developer experience is a shared value across the organization.
What you’ll bring
Deep experience with developer tooling, DevEx strategies, and testing frameworks at scale.
Experience leading platform or transformation initiatives across multiple teams.
Proven ability to influence without authority and collaborate across functions.
Familiarity with DevOps workflows and CI/CD pipelines.
Strong written and verbal communication skills in a remote-first environment.
A product mindset with a passion for empowering developers.
Alignment with GitLab values, especially collaboration, iteration, and transparency.
